Homemade Granola Bars
Ensure you make this healthy snack a nutritious one by making this simple recipe at home.
Yield: About 15-20 bars
Ingredients
- 4 1/2 cups rolled oats
- 1 cup whole wheat flour, or spelt
- 1 tsp. baking soda - 1 tsp. vanilla
- 1 cup butter, softened - 1 cup honey
- Choice of add-ins: mini semi-sweet chocolate chips, chopped nuts, peanut butter, soy butter, cocoa powder, dried fruits, sunflower seeds, coconut
Instructions
Lightly butter a 9×13-inch pan.
In a large mixing bowl, combine butter and honey first. Then add all ingredients except add-ins. Beat hard until combined. Stir in add-ins.
Press mixture into pan, really jam it in there using your hands so the bars don’t fall apart.
Bake at 325 degrees for 25 minutes until golden brown.
Let cool for at least 10 minutes before cutting into bars. Let bars cool completely in pan before removing and serving.
